Abstract
The present invention is a composite medical device having a non-bioabsorbable implantable tissue repair or reconstruction component and a resilient bioabsorbable support member component that aids in deployment and placement of the implantable component at a surgical site. Following deployment, the support member component is readily bioabsorbed and removed from the implantable component. The invention is particularly useful in laproscopic, endoluminal, and other surgical procedures.
